1. Buang bagian desimal dan pertahankan bagian integer
Parseint (5/2)
2. Bulatkan ke atas, tambahkan 1 ke bagian integer jika ada desimal.
Math.ceil (5/2)
3. Round.
Math.round (5/2)
4. Bulat ke bawah
Math.Floor (5/2)
Metode Objek Matematika
FF: Firefox, N: Netscape, IE: Internet Explorer
Deskripsi metode ff n yaitu
ABS (x) Mengembalikan nilai absolut dari angka 1 2 3
ACOS (x) Mengembalikan nilai cosinus terbalik dari angka 1 2 3
Asin (x) Mengembalikan nilai sinus terbalik dari angka 1 2 3
atan (x) mengembalikan nilai xctangent x sebagai nilai antara -pi/2 dan pi/2 radian 1 2 3
atan2 (y, x) mengembalikan sudut dari sumbu x ke titik (x, y) (antara -pi/2 dan pi/2 radian) 1 2 3
ceil (x) mengumpulkan angka. 1 2 3
cos (x) Mengembalikan kosinus dari angka 1 2 3
exp (x) mengembalikan eksponen e. 1 2 3
Lantai (x) Bulatkan angka. 1 2 3
Log (x) Mengembalikan logaritma alami dari angka (bawah adalah E) 1 2 3
Max (x, y) mengembalikan nilai tertinggi dalam x dan y 1 2 3
min (x, y) mengembalikan nilai terendah x dan y 1 2 3
pow (x, y) mengembalikan kekuatan y x 1 2 3
acak () mengembalikan angka acak antara 0 ~ 1 2 3
putaran (x) putaran angka ke bilangan bulat terdekat 1 2 3
sin (x) mengembalikan sinus angka 1 2 3
sqrt (x) mengembalikan akar kuadrat dari angka 1 2 3
tan (x) mengembalikan garis singgung sudut 1 2 3
tosource () mewakili kode sumber objek 1 4 -
valueOf () Mengembalikan nilai asli dari objek matematika
Kasus kode:
Salinan kode adalah sebagai berikut:
<type skrip = "Teks/JavaScript">
//Meringkaskan
fungsi getResult (num) {
mengembalikan parseint (num);
}
// bulat ke n bit di belakang num
fungsi getResult (num, n) {
return math.round (num*math.pow (10, n))/math.pow (10, n);
}
// mencegat n bit
fungsi getResult (num, n) {
return num.toString (). REPLACE (REGEXP baru ("^(//-? // d*//.? // d {0,"+n+"}) (// d*) $"), "$ 1")+0;
}
</script>
lainnya:
Salinan kode adalah sebagai berikut:
var mlength = textmn.length;
var mfirst = parseInt (mLength/60);
//Meringkaskan
// peringatan (mlength);
var mLast = mLength; // Ambil sisanya
if (mLast> 0) {
$ (". Mood_content"). Tinggi ((mfirst+1)*20);
}